Srinagar, Dec 17 : Four flights were cancelled at Srinagar International Airport on Wednesday morning due to bad weather and operational reasons, officials said.

According to airport authorities, IndiGo flight 6E-6164 scheduled to depart for Amritsar at 9 am was cancelled due to bad weather at the destination airport.

Another IndiGo flight, 6E-6962 to Kolkata, scheduled for departure at 6.45 pm, was cancelled for operational reasons

Two SpiceJet flights—SG-180 and SG-160—both bound for Delhi and scheduled to depart at 1.30 pm and 5.45 pm respectively, were also cancelled due to operational reasons.

Officials said flight operations at the airport remain subject to weather conditions, and passengers have been advised to check with airlines for the latest updates.(KNS).
